Roman Civilization began in 509 B.C. and ended in 476 A.D. How long did Roman Civilization last?

Respuesta :

vcao88 vcao88
  • 04-04-2022

Answer:

Add 509 and 476; The Roman Era lasted for a total of 985 years from 509 B.C to 476 A.D.
